Greetings brethren,

Our journey west ended this week in southwestern Montana at the home of Linda’s brother and sister-in-law near the town of Victor. Part of this journey followed the Oregon Trail through Nebraska and into Wyoming. Part of it then traversed the trails of Lewis and Clark’s Expedition—in particular along the trail of one of the Expedition’s members, John Colter. He travelled through much of what is now Yellowstone National Park. Finally, we cruised along modern highways that basically followed parts of the Bozeman Trail into Montana.

Along with the Santé Fe and other trails that opened up the American southwest, these trails were pathways that inter-connected the extended territory God provided for the descendants of the Israelite tribe of Manasseh. 

As with especially the eastern half of Manasseh’s inheritance in ancient Israel, the modern homeland has included significant numbers of non-Israelite populations. History repeats itself, so ancient tribal proclivities often have modern counterparts. Judges chapters 11 and 12 record the historical battles of ancient Manasseh under the leadership of their judge Jephthah in the 1100’s B.C. when forced to go to war first against the army of the Ammonites, and then against the Israelite tribe of Ephraim (a sort of harbinger of America’s Revolutionary War). 

As part of the heritage of Joseph the favored son of Jacob, Manasseh along with Ephraim inherited a double blessing of territorial jurisdiction compared to the rest of the sons of Jacob/Israel. But God also promised eventual judgment on those descendants of Jacob if they persistently refused God’s revealed standard of conduct—based on His divine law. 

Sadly, our America has chosen in these end times to persistently and now systematically reject God’s way. Prophesied trouble is on the horizon, but after that—a wonderful future under the soon-coming leadership of Jesus Christ in the Kingdom of God on earth. Godspeed that event and that great day!
